What is a Car Code Grabber?

A vehicle code interceptor is a technical tool designed to intercept encrypted signals transmitted between a vehicle remote and the automobile security. This equipment is primarily used for automotive testing and professional diagnostics.

Grabber systems are compatible with different vehicle brands and encryption systems.

How Does a Code Grabber Work?

The interceptor system functions by recording the RF signal between your vehicle key and the car. Here’s the working mechanism:

  1. The interceptor scans the RF spectrum used by vehicle keys
  2. When a signal is detected, the interceptor intercepts the signal
  3. The intercepted signal is saved in the device memory
  4. The signal can be examined or replayed later
  5. Premium grabbers can decode security algorithms

Device Specs of Grabber Systems

Operating Frequencies

Professional code grabbers operate on multiple ranges:

  • 315 MHz: Used by North America
  • 433 MHz: Common for Europe
  • 868 MHz: Newer vehicles
  • 915 MHz: Select models
  • 2.4 GHz: Smart keys

Related Technologies

Code Grabber vs Keyless Repeater

Understanding the difference between interceptors and other technologies:

  • Grabber device: Captures and saves codes
  • Repeater device: Boosts transmissions in real-time
  • Relay equipment: Dual-unit equipment for distance bridging

Defense Strategies

Defense Methods

For automobile owners worried about safety:

  • Employ Signal blocking bags for car keys
  • Turn on sleep functions on advanced fobs
  • Park in secure locations
  • Install supplementary systems
  • Stay informed security advisories
